University's �200m spending plan

A sports institute at Jordanstown is among the projects
The University of Ulster has announced that it is spending a total of �200m on new buildings and facilities.

Vice Chancellor Professor Gerry McKenna said the building programme had already started and is to be spread over the next five or six years.

According to the university, this is the largest investment programme in the history of higher education in Northern Ireland.

The project features a wide range of new academic and recreational facilities.

These include a centre for engineering and informatics at Magee College in Londonderry; a sports institute at the university's Jordanstown campus, outside Belfast and a bio-science research centre at its campus in Coleraine, County Londonderry.

Fifth campus

A �30m re-development of the old art college at York Street, Belfast is likely to go ahead as a joint project with the private sector.

The huge investment also includes �70m for a new campus in west Belfast, which was given the go-ahead in February.

Known as the Springvale Educational Village, it is to be the university's fifth campus in the province, with places for up to 4,500 students.

Also included in the investment, is �10m for further development at Magee College in Londonderry.

The university has raised half of the �200m and has said it is confident of being able to raise the rest of the money over the next five or six years.
